Who books car service in Cranberry Township
Office-park travelers, hotel guests, and suburban residents use reserved cars for airport runs and Downtown meetings. Cranberry sits north of the airport corridor, so many runs never enter the Fort Pitt Tunnel, but your exact address still controls the quote.
Streets and institutions to name on the itinerary
Give Cranberry Woods, offices along Route 19 or Route 228, UPMC Passavant-Cranberry, or a home address with gate notes. Give the building, visitor entrance, and any gate code. Newer residential streets may need a pin plus a mobile number.

Local planning notes
Office parks often have visitor entrances and gate codes. A hotel check-in wait can be written into a transfer quote; book hourly if you want the vehicle held for meetings.
